Clinical Psychologists: Training
The question
To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, what steps is his Department taking to ensure those who have completed NHS funded trainee schemes studying taught doctorate programmes for Clinical Psychologists stay working in the NHS.
Answered by Karin Smyth
Decisions about recruitment are a matter for individual National Health Service employers, who manage this at a local level to ensure they have the staff they need to deliver safe and effective care.
NHS England and employers promote the retention of clinical psychologists through offering a significant amount of post-qualification training and opportunities to progress to senior grades whilst retaining them in clinical practice.
